Based on a popular bbc radio series broadcast last year, this beautifully illustrated book demonstrates how much we can learn about past societies from the things they have left behind. This is a superb book in which neil mcgregor, the director of the british museum, takes us through world history by looking in turn at 100 beautifully illustrated objects from a chipping tool made almost 2 million years ago through to a solar panel of the present day. A history of ireland in 100 objects was a joint project by the irish times, the national museum of ireland, and the royal irish academy to define one hundred archaeological or cultural objects that are important in the history of ireland.
